This is as close you can get to a time machine back to Memphis in the 1950s!'Originally issued in the fall of 1957-the first long-player for Sam Phillips' Sun Records-Johnny Cash with His Hot and Blue Guitar! Showcases the stripped-down sound that would make the future Man in Black one of the most enduring and respected musicians of the 20th century. Backed only by his 'Tennessee Two' (Luther Perkins on lead guitar and Marshall Grant on upright bass) and augmented by Phillips' signature studioslapback that gave Cash's 'boom-chicka-boom' sound it's kick, Hot and Blue Guitar! #is the album that introduced many to Cash's sonorous baritone.This CD\/SACD features Cash's first three single A-sides for Sun, all self-penned: 'Cry, Cry, Cry,' (a No. 14 country chart hit), 'So Doggone Lonesome' (which peaked at No. 4 on the country charts) and Cash's signature original 'I Walk The Line.' The latter was a No. 1 country smash for six non-consecutive weeks in the summer of 1956 before crossing over into the Top 20 of Billboard's pop charts. Additional standouts include Cash's renditions of fare like 'The Wreck Of The Old 97' and 'Rock Island Line,' as well as a fourth original song, 'Folsom Prison Blues'-which would top the country charts more than a decade later when Cash performed it as part of his landmark 1968 live album At Folsom Prison. Johnny Cash with His Hot and Blue Guitar! #was sourced from flat transfers of Â¼' monaural master reels sourced from the Sun Records archive, which compiled the label's original 7' single masters. This exhaustive research process resulted in the best-sounding tape version of each of the 12 songs on the original album, and the best available sources for the extra tracks.Kevin Gray at CoHEARent Audio mastered the original repertoire tracks, offering crystal-clear audio fidelity that sacrifices none of the spark of the original recordings. The entirety of the original repertoire of 12 songs, and 2 of the 3 extra tracks are mastered directly from Sun's original analog master tapes to DSD. The only existing source for the 'Cry, Cry, Cry' Alternate Take is 16\/44 digital but we felt it's inclusion crucial for artistic and historical merit.Gus Skinas at the Super Audio Center prepared Kevin Gray's mastered DSD files for the original repertoire, and mastered the extra tracks in the DSD domain using Gray's mastering notes as a guide.IR's Tom Vadakan beautifully restored the album art, and our CD\/SACD features a link to full liners notes by noted Sun Records historian and two-time Grammy Award winner Colin Escott.
